Definite Integration question

2023 · 24 Jan · Shift 1 · Q43

JEE MainMathematicsDefinite IntegrationNumerical+4 / −1
The value of 8π∫0π2(cos⁡x)2023(sin⁡x)2023+(cos⁡x)2023dx{8 \over \pi }\int\limits_0^{{\pi \over 2}} {{{{{(\cos x)}^{2023}}} \over {{{(\sin x)}^{2023}} + {{(\cos x)}^{2023}}}}dx}π8​0∫2π​​(sinx)2023+(cosx)2023(cosx)2023​dx is ‾\underline{\hspace{2cm}}​
Numerical answer
View written solutionFree

Correct answer: 2

  1. Let I=∫0π/2(cos⁡x)2023(sin⁡x)2023+(cos⁡x)2023 dx.I=\int_0^{\pi/2} \frac{(\cos x)^{2023}}{(\sin x)^{2023}+(\cos x)^{2023}}\,dx.I=∫0π/2​(sinx)2023+(cosx)2023(cosx)2023​dx.

We need to find 8πI.\frac{8}{\pi}I.π8​I.

  1. Use the standard substitution x↦π2−x.x\mapsto \frac{\pi}{2}-x.x↦2π​−x. Then sin⁡(π2−x)=cos⁡x,cos⁡(π2−x)=sin⁡x.\sin\left(\frac{\pi}{2}-x\right)=\cos x,\qquad \cos\left(\frac{\pi}{2}-x\right)=\sin x.sin(2π​−x)=cosx,cos(2π​−x)=sinx. So, I=∫0π/2(sin⁡x)2023(cos⁡x)2023+(sin⁡x)2023 dx.I=\int_0^{\pi/2} \frac{(\sin x)^{2023}}{(\cos x)^{2023}+(\sin x)^{2023}}\,dx.I=∫0π/2​(cosx)2023+(sinx)2023(sinx)2023​dx.

  2. Add the two expressions for III: 2I=∫0π/2[(cos⁡x)2023(sin⁡x)2023+(cos⁡x)2023+(sin⁡x)2023(cos⁡x)2023+(sin⁡x)2023]dx.2I=\int_0^{\pi/2}\left[\frac{(\cos x)^{2023}}{(\sin x)^{2023}+(\cos x)^{2023}}+\frac{(\sin x)^{2023}}{(\cos x)^{2023}+(\sin x)^{2023}}\right]dx.2I=∫0π/2​[(sinx)2023+(cosx)2023(cosx)2023​+(cosx)2023+(sinx)2023(sinx)2023​]dx.

Inside the bracket, (cos⁡x)2023(sin⁡x)2023+(cos⁡x)2023+(sin⁡x)2023(sin⁡x)2023+(cos⁡x)2023=1.\frac{(\cos x)^{2023}}{(\sin x)^{2023}+(\cos x)^{2023}}+\frac{(\sin x)^{2023}}{(\sin x)^{2023}+(\cos x)^{2023}}=1.(sinx)2023+(cosx)2023(cosx)2023​+(sinx)2023+(cosx)2023(sinx)2023​=1. Therefore, 2I=∫0π/21 dx=π2.2I=\int_0^{\pi/2}1\,dx=\frac\pi2.2I=∫0π/2​1dx=2π​. Hence, I=π4.I=\frac\pi4.I=4π​.

  1. Now compute the required value: 8πI=8π⋅π4=2.\frac{8}{\pi}I=\frac{8}{\pi}\cdot \frac\pi4=2.π8​I=π8​⋅4π​=2.

Therefore, the value of the given expression is 2.\boxed{2}.2​.
